 By: Shapleigh S.B. No. 250


 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 AN ACT
 relating to a report on use of money from the Texas Enterprise Fund.
 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
 SECTION 1. Section 481.079(a), Government Code, is amended
 to read as follows:
 (a) Before the beginning of each regular session of the
 legislature, the governor shall submit to the lieutenant governor,
 the speaker of the house of representatives, and each other member
 of the legislature a report on grants made under Section 481.078
 that states:
 (1) the number of direct jobs each recipient committed
 to create in this state;
 (2) the number of direct jobs each recipient created
 in this state;
 (3) the median wage of the jobs each recipient created
 in this state;
 (4) [the amount of capital investment each recipient
 committed to expend or allocate per project in this state;
 [(5)     the amount of capital investment each recipient
 expended or allocated per project in this state;
 [(6)] the total amount of grants made to each
 recipient;
 (5) [(7)] the average amount of money granted in this
 state for each job created in this state by grant recipients;
 (6) [(8)] the number of jobs created in this state by
 grant recipients in each sector of the North American Industry
 Classification System (NAICS); [and]
 (7) [(9)] the total amount of tax credits, local
 incentives, and other money or credits distributed to each
 recipient by governmental entities of this state;
 (8)  the percentage of money granted to recipients with
 fewer than 100 employees;
 (9) the geographical distribution of grants by county;
 (10)  the effect of grants on employment, personal
 income, and capital investment in this state and in each regional
 planning commission area; and
 (11) [of] the number of [direct] jobs each recipient
 created in this state[, the number of positions created] that
 provide full health benefits for employees.
 SECTION 2. This Act takes effect September 1, 2009.
